Understanding Senior Care Options



Navigating the landscape of senior treatment options can be overwhelming, but understanding the readily available selections is crucial for making educated decisions. Senior treatment encompasses a vast spectrum of solutions created to help older adults in keeping their lifestyle. At the core of these choices are home care services, which offer aid with day-to-day tasks directly in the person's home. This can consist of personal treatment, friendship, and homemaking services.


One more common choice is aided living facilities, which offer a more common living setting with assistance for everyday tasks and accessibility to social and entertainment tasks. For those calling for extra intensive healthcare, assisted living home deliver 24-hour supervision and health care solutions tailored to fulfill intricate requirements.


Additionally, grown-up day treatment centers offer respite for caregivers while offering organized tasks and social interaction for seniors throughout the day. Hospice and palliative treatment emphasis on comfort and assistance for individuals with incurable ailments, highlighting quality of life. Each alternative offers distinct advantages and difficulties, necessitating mindful consideration to make certain the selected solution straightens with the elderly's way of life and choices. Comprehending these categories can significantly assist in the choice procedure.


Assessing Individual Needs

To pick one of the most ideal elderly treatment choice, it is vital to assess the specific demands of the older grownup. This analysis ought to encompass physical, emotional, and social demands, as well as the individual's preferences and worths. Begin by reviewing the senior's health and wellness standing, consisting of any kind of persistent problems, movement issues, and cognitive capabilities. Understanding these elements is essential in establishing the level of care called for, whether it be independent living, aided living, or competent nursing treatment.


Following, think about the emotional and emotional facets. Numerous seniors worth freedom and familiarity, so it's vital to assess their wish for freedom and the influence of social seclusion. Involving the older adult in conversations about their preferences can provide beneficial understanding right into their treatment needs.


Furthermore, family dynamics and support group play a significant role. Entail member of the family in the analysis process to get an extensive understanding of the elderly's setting and support network. By extensively reviewing these aspects, caregivers can develop a tailored treatment plan that boosts the quality of life for the older adult while addressing their distinct demands and preferences.


Evaluating Treatment Facilities



When assessing treatment centers for seniors, it is necessary to consider different elements that add to both the quality of care and the general living environment. Begin by analyzing the center's licensing and accreditation, ensuring it follows state policies, which can indicate a commitment to high standards of treatment.

Observe the certifications and training of caretakers, along with their technique to resident interactions, which mirrors the center's society and values




In addition, check out the center's amenities and services, including social tasks, physical treatment, and dish choices, to guarantee they align with the seniors' requirements and choices. The physical setting must also be considered; evaluate the sanitation, safety functions, and general ease of access of the facility.

Financial Factors To Consider



The decision to select a care facility for senior citizens typically entails significant monetary considerations that can impact both temporary and lasting preparation. It is important to assess the complete expense of treatment, which might include regular monthly costs, added fees for solutions like medicine administration, and any kind of upfront entrance charges. Recognizing the rates structure of numerous centers will allow families to make educated choices.


Insurance coverage options, such as long-term care insurance or Medicare, can likewise affect financial planning. It's important to identify what services are covered and to what degree, as this can significantly influence out-of-pocket costs. Furthermore, family members ought to take into consideration the capacity for future price increases, as lots of facilities adjust prices yearly.


Another factor to consider is the funding resources offered for treatment, including personal financial savings, pensions, or federal government assistance programs. Involving a financial expert specializing in elder treatment can supply important insights right into budgeting for these expenses and discovering offered sources.


Eventually, an extensive financial assessment will aid family members navigate the intricacies of senior care, ensuring they pick an option that straightens with their financial capabilities and their liked one's needs.


Making the Transition



Making the transition to an elderly care facility can be a tough and emotional process for both elders and their households. It is vital to approach this change with level of sensitivity and prep work to reduce the stress and anxiety often associated with moving from a familiar home atmosphere to a new living circumstance.


Before making the shift, family members need to take part in open conversations concerning the decision. This discussion can aid attend to problems and ensure that the elderly's choices and requirements are prioritized. Entailing the elderly in the decision-making procedure fosters a feeling of control and top article dignity.


As soon as a center has been chosen, planning for the action is crucial. This includes organizing items, individualizing the brand-new area, and establishing a routine that includes familiar activities. Urge member of the family and pals to go to regularly during the initial change duration to provide psychological assistance.
